A digital camera uses a CCD detector that is 7.2 mm wide and 5.3 mm tall. (a) If the detector is rated for “4.0 megapixels” and the pixels are equally spaced, what is the distance between the centers of adjacent pixels on the CCD chip? (Use Figure 26.23 to model the arrangement of CCD pixels and ignore any space between the edges of adjacent pixels.) (b) When an object is at infinity, the lens is found to be 1.5 cm from the CCD detector. What is the focal length of the lens? (c) If an object is placed 30 cm from the lens, what spacing between the lens and the CCD detector is required for the image to be at the detector?
